Fixed it, a small Christmas miracle, turns out I did not do a good job removing the old gasket material from the crank case. In my defense, after 240k miles it was really hard to distinguish between the two, the gasket had solidified to the point scrapping it with a screwdriver didn't even etch the old gasket. I had to use a razor blade to get it off.
With that done right, no more leak. Thanks for your help guys.
